## Splitwing Assignment Service — Runbook Fragment

For this week's sync: Splitwing hands out A/B bucket assignments via a sticky hash, so restarts shouldn't reshuffle users — if folks report flapping variants, check the salt table first, not the hashing code. Rollouts pause automatically if the assignment write queue backs up past 10k. Quick sanity loop: hit the /bucket endpoint twice with the same anon ID and confirm matching variants. To inspect assignments directly, query the bucketing store using the following connection:

primary connection of yagep-kahip = redis://giliel_svc:zYiKsLL2PLpfPL@db-348f.xolmarsys.corp:5432/fenwyn

## Step 4: Upgrade the renderer

Inkpress 3.x replaces the legacy PDF invoice pipeline. Plugin authors must rebuild against the new layout API; old template hooks are removed. Margins and font embedding are now set centrally, not per plugin. Before registering your plugin, verify the service is running with these configuration values.

config for kagup-hahig:
druwyn:
  pin: 2801
  metrics_host: metrics.druwyn.zemvarlabs.internal
  tenant: sorius
  seal: seal_798a43d7

Subject: DR drill Thursday — FeedCheck validator

Team,

Quick heads-up before the sync: Thursday 10:00 we run the quarterly disaster-recovery drill for FeedCheck. We'll simulate loss of the primary validation cluster in Ostermark and fail over to the standby.

During the drill, the admin console will be locked. On-call (Priya's rotation) handles the failover; everyone else just verifies their feeds re-validate within 15 minutes.

If you need emergency console access mid-drill, use the break-glass flow and supply the passphrase below.

vault phrase of tajop-haduf = holath-brivan-wenax

Ticket AGT-512: Harvestline telemetry gateway. Gateway drops packets from third-party implement plugins when uplink latency exceeds 800ms. Fix adds a bounded retry queue and exposes a backpressure flag in the plugin SDK. Plugin authors must handle the new flag; no wire-format changes. Tested against the Plowmark and Siltrow reference plugins. Needs sign-off before the SDK release, from the owner named below.

signatory, kaweg-fawig: Zorys Druys Jorius Novael